Hard Money Loans in San Diego - Parameters
Our San Diego hard money loans lender terms are customized for each and every loan that we close. The following ranges are average for hard money loans that we have closed in San Diego County, California. We will make exceptions to these parameters based on the strength of the loan application. All terms below are for business purpose hard money loans only (loan that are not for personal, family or household purposes). We will consider consumer hard money loans on investment properties in San Diego County – contact us for more information.
| California Hard Money Guidelines* | Rates | Starting at 9%+ for 1st Liens Starting at 10%+ for 2nd Liens |
|---|---|
| LTV | Residential to 65% Commercial to 60% Expanded LTVs to 75% case by case |
| Loan Term | Up to 2 years - interest only Up to 10 years - Partially/Fully amortized |
| Loan Size | $50k to $25mm |
| Closing Time | Residential: 1 week +/- Commercial: 2 weeks +/- |

A hard money loan is a short-term, asset-based loan typically used by real estate investors and developers. Unlike traditional bank loans that heavily weigh the borrower’s personal credit and income history, hard money lenders focus primarily on the value of the property being used as collateral. This makes them ideal for purchasing distressed properties, completing renovations, or securing quick funding when traditional financing isn’t an option.
Speed is the primary advantage of hard money lending, especially in a highly competitive market like San Diego. While traditional mortgages can take 30 to 45 days (or longer) to process, direct hard money lenders can often approve requests within 24 hours and fund loans in as little as 5 to 14 days.
Real estate professionals in San Diego typically use hard money for:
Fix-and-Flips: Purchasing a distressed home, funding the renovations, and selling it for a profit.
Bridge Loans: Securing temporary financing to “bridge the gap” between buying a new property and selling an existing one.
Real Estate Auctions: Having the cash-like buying power necessary to win bids at property auctions.
Construction Loans: Securing the capital needed to develop raw land or build new properties.
Because hard money loans carry a higher risk for the lender and prioritize speed and flexibility, they come with higher interest rates than conventional mortgages. Rates generally range from 8% to 15%, depending on the lender, the borrower’s experience, and the Loan-to-Value (LTV) ratio. Terms are usually short, ranging from 6 to 24 months, and typically feature interest-only monthly payments with a balloon payment due at the end of the term.
Not necessarily. While a good credit score can help you secure better terms, hard money lenders are far more concerned with the “hard asset”—the property itself. If there is significant equity in the property or you are providing a substantial down payment (often 20% to 30%), a direct lender can often approve the loan even if your credit history isn’t perfect.

San Diego Mortgage Broker vs Hard Money Lenders
Navigating San Diego’s hyper-competitive real estate market requires more than just a sharp eye for a lucrative property—it requires immediate, liquid capital. When a prime fix-and-flip or coastal multi-family hits the market, the funding source you choose dictates whether you close the deal or lose it to a cash buyer. Many local investors mistakenly lump San Diego mortgage brokers and direct hard money lenders into the same bucket, assuming both lead to the same result. But when the escrow clock is ticking, understanding who is actually writing the check versus who is merely shuffling paperwork is the difference between a successful project and a devastating missed opportunity.
Mortgage Broker
Let’s be completely transparent: a San Diego mortgage broker is essentially a professional middleman. They do not control the capital they are offering. Instead, they package your loan scenario and shop it to a disjointed network of outside institutions or private investors, hoping to secure a match. This fragmented approach inherently invites critical delays, hidden broker fees, and rigid third-party underwriting criteria. Because a broker is entirely dependent on someone else's final approval—a process often bogged down by institutional red tape and endless requests for tax returns—your time-sensitive deal is left floating in limbo, jeopardizing both your earnest money and your closing timeline.
